#9123d1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9123d1 is composed of 56.9% red, 13.7%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.6% cyan, 83.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 277.9 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 47.8%. #9123d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ff46ff with #2300a3.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#9123d1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050107 is the darkest color, while #fbf6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9123d1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b777d is the less saturated color, while #9807ed is the most saturated one.
